ITK,即 Insight Segmentation and Registration Toolkit,是由美国国家卫生院下属的国立医学图书馆开发的一款 医学图像处理软件包。它是一个开源的、跨平台的影像分析扩展软件工具,主要用于医学图像处理,但也可以应用于其他领域的图像处理任务。
ITK采用管道模块结构设计,提供了丰富的图像分割与配准算法程序。它主要使用C++编写,并提供了Python的接口,使得开发者可以在Python环境中使用。此外,ITK还支持Tcl、Java等其他语言,并有一个由软件开发者和使用者组成的自我维持的社区。
ITK的主要功能包括:
图像分割:
将图像分解成多个区域或对象。
图像配准:
将两幅或多幅图像对齐,使得它们在空间上相互对应。
图像处理:
提供了一系列图像处理工具,如滤波、增强、特征提取等。
ITK广泛应用于医学图像处理、计算机辅助诊断、遥感图像分析等领域。它支持多种医学图像格式,如CT、MRI和超声波图像,并可以与其他医学影像软件(如VTK)结合使用。
总的来说,ITK是一个功能强大的开源医学图像处理软件包,适用于多种图像分析任务,并且有一个活跃的开发者社区提供支持和扩展。
声明:
本站内容均来自网络,如有侵权,请联系我们。